hello everyone, i've been struggling to get my NPM up and running for days. my configuration looks like this: i have a NPM service in a proxmox LXC, which connects to an Ubiquity Cloud Gateway Ultra, and that link is routed through my ISP's router (Proximus). i'm using a domain purchased from Namecheap, and it's managed by Cloudflare. i've been using Cloudflare tunnels for a while, but now I want to switch to NPM. from what i understand, i need to set up a double port forward on both my ISP and the cloud gateway (refer to the screens). you can also see my Cloudflare configuration there. anyone with experience, please help me out! thank you all.
